Suoritinbussit, also known as processor buses or CPU buses, are a set of electrical pathways that connect the central processing unit (CPU) to other components within a computer system. These buses are crucial for data transfer, allowing the CPU to communicate with memory, peripherals, and other essential hardware. The primary function of a suoritinbussi is to facilitate the movement of instructions and data between the CPU and the rest of the system's architecture.
